Doha, Qatar: The Syro-Malabar Cultural Association (SMCA) Qatar is celebrating its Silver Jubilee in 2025, marking 25 years of excellence in artistic, sports, cultural, social, and charitable activities. Since its inception, SMCA has played a vital role in promoting community welfare through various initiatives in arts, sports, education, and healthcare. As part of the grand celebrations, the organization has announced the launch of new projects and programs aimed at further enhancing societal development and nurturing talents among its members.


The highlight of the Silver Jubilee celebrations will be "Silver Beats," a mega event scheduled for Thursday evening, May 8, 2025, at the QNCC Exhibition Hall. The event will feature the popular Malayalam film star Nivin Pauly as the special guest, adding glamour and excitement for movie lovers and youth alike. The musical segment will showcase performances by the renowned Bennett Band, led by celebrated playback singer Shweta Mohan, and "Nj Live," led by famous actor and singer Neeraj Madhav, making his first musical performance in Doha. Together, they promise an unforgettable musical extravaganza for art and music enthusiasts.

The SMCA leadership emphasized that this jubilee year would not only be a celebration of past achievements but also a new beginning, with plans to implement larger and more impactful charitable projects. Building on its strong history of community service, SMCA will initiate extensive charitable programs and organize educational and healthcare seminars featuring experts, aiming to introduce innovative models to benefit society. General Secretary Ajo Antony reiterated SMCA’s commitment to advancing services in education, healthcare, and welfare in collaboration with major Indian community organizations under the Indian Embassy, including ICC, ICBF, and ISC.

At a press conference, SMCA President Joy Antony Elavathinkal announced that "Silver Beats," led by two of the brightest new-generation playback singers along with star guest Nivin Pauly, would be a grand visual and musical feast for Doha’s art and music lovers. The organization extended a warm invitation to all music fans, as well as media representatives, to join in the celebrations. The press meet was attended by SMCA office bearers and executive members, with Vice President Jito James delivering the vote of thanks.
